Polypropylene is the best thermoplastic for chemical uses resins and partially crystalline resin belonging to the engineering thermoplastic family of polyolefins. PPH Ball Valve is obtained through the polymerization of propylene (C3H6) with the aid of catalysts.
PPH Ball Valve provides optimum use in chemical piping systems, the latest-generation Polypropylene Homopolymer variant, or PP-H, offers excellent performance at working temperatures of up to 100° C and high resistance to chemicals due to the excellent physical and thermal characteristics of the resin.
The PPH line in the latest-generation Polypropylene Homopolymer consists of a comprehensive range of pipes, fittings, & ball valve,s and valves for use in the construction of process and service lines for conveying pressurized industrial fluids and for maximum operating temperatures of up to 100° C.
The entire line is made of Polypropylene Homopolymer resins MRS 100 (PP-H 100) according to the classification DIN 8077-8078, DIN 16962 and approved by DIBt – Deutsches Institut für Bautechnik for use in industrial processes. The main properties of the latest-generation Homopolymer resins are:
• High chemical resistance:
In addition to ensuring excellent chemical resistance, especially against halogens and alkaline solutions, the use of PP-H resins with special additives also ensures.
excellent mechanical properties when conveying detergents and similar chemicals. PP-H resins are also fully compatible with the transport of drinking, unconditioned,
demineralized and spa water for therapeutic and kinotherapeutic uses.
• Excellent thermal stability:
Particularly in the intermediate temperature range between 10° C and 80°. C typical of industrial applications, PP-H ensures excellent mechanical strength and impact resistance with high safety factors. • Resistance to aging: PP-H resins have a high circumferential breaking strength (MinimumRequired Strength MRS ≥ 10.0 MPa at 20°C) and allow long installation lifetimes without showing any signs of significant physical-mechanical deterioration.

The Kv 100 flow coefficient is the
Q flow rate of litres per minute of
water at a temperature of 20°C that
will generate Δp= 1 bar pressure
drop at a certain valve position. The
Kv100 values shown in the table are
calculated with the valve completely
open.
